## Synopsis ##
```c++
try {
// Init SDL; will be automatically deinitialized when the object is destroyed
SDL2pp::SDL sdl(SDL_INIT_VIDEO);
// Straightforward wrappers around corresponding SDL2 objects
// These take full care of proper object destruction and error checking
SDL2pp::Window window("libSDL2pp demo",
SDL_WINDOWPOS_UNDEFINED, SDL_WINDOWPOS_UNDEFINED,
640, 480, SDL_WINDOW_RESIZABLE);
SDL2pp::Renderer renderer(window, -1, SDL_RENDERER_ACCELERATED);
SDL2pp::Texture sprite1(renderer, SDL_PIXELFORMAT_ARGB8888,
SDL_TEXTUREACCESS_STATIC, 16, 16);
SDL2pp::Texture sprite2(renderer, "sprite.png"); // SDL_image support
unsigned char pixels[16 * 16 * 4];
// Note proper constructor for Rect
sprite1.Update(SDL2pp::Rect(0, 0, 16, 16), pixels, 16 * 4);
renderer.Clear();
// Also note a way to specify null rects and points
renderer.Copy(sprite1, SDL2pp::NullOpt, SDL2pp::NullOpt);
// Copy() is overloaded, providing access to both SDL_RenderCopy and SDL_RenderCopyEx
renderer.Copy(sprite2, SDL2pp::NullOpt, SDL2pp::NullOpt, 45.0);
renderer.Present();
// You can still access wrapped C SDL types
SDL_Renderer* sdl_renderer = renderer.Get();
// Of course, C SDL2 API is still perfectly valid
SDL_Delay(2000);
// All SDL objects are released at this point or if an error occurs
} catch (SDL2pp::Exception& e) {
// Exception stores SDL_GetError() result
std::cerr << "Exception: " << e.what() << std::endl;
std::cerr << "SDL Error: " << e.GetSDLError() << std::endl;
}
```

To install the library systemwide, run:
```cmake . && make && make install```
cmake . && make && make install
You can change installation prefix with CMAKE_INSTALL_PREFIX cmake
variable:
```cmake -DCMAKE_INSTALL_PREFIX=/usr/local . && make && make install```
cmake -DCMAKE_INSTALL_PREFIX=/usr/local . && make && make install
SDL2pp installs pkg-config file, so it can be used with any build
system which interacts with pkg-config, including CMake and GNU
